資料介紹
1. Introduction to the SD Card . 1-1
1.1. Scope 1-2
1.2. Product Models .. 1-2
1.3. System Features.. 1-2
1.4. SD Card Standard.. 1-3
1.5. Functional Description . 1-3
1.5.1. Flash Technology Independence 1-4
1.5.2. Defect and Error Management? 1-4
1.5.3. Copyright Protection? 1-4
1.5.4. Endurance . 1-5
1.5.5. Wear Leveling 1-5
1.5.6. Using the Erase Command 1-5
1.5.7. Automatic Sleep Mode 1-5
1.5.8. Hot Insertion? 1-5
1.5.9. SD Card—SD Bus Mode .. 1-6
1.5.9.1. SD Card Standard Compliance? 1-6
1.5.9.2. Negotiating Operation Conditions . 1-6
1.5.9.3. Card Acquisition and Identification.. 1-6
1.5.9.4. Card Status. 1-6
1.5.9.5. Memory Array Partitioning 1-7
1.5.9.6. Read and Write Operations 1-9
1.5.9.7. Data Transfer Rate . 1-9
1.5.9.8. Data Protection in the Flash Card .. 1-10
1.5.9.9. Erase . 1-10
1.5.9.10. Write Protection 1-10
1.5.9.11. Copy Bit 1-10
1.5.9.12. The CSD Register? 1-10
1.5.10. SD Card—SPI Mode. 1-10
1.5.10.1. Negotiating Operating Conditions .. 1-11
1.5.10.2. Card Acquisition and Identification 1-11
1.5.10.3. Card Status.. 1-11
1.5.10.4. Memory Array Partitioning. 1-11
1.5.10.5. Read and Write Operations. 1-11
1.5.10.6. Data Transfer Rate .. 1-11
1.5.10.7. Data Protection in the SD Card. 1-11
1.5.10.8. Erase .. 1-11
1.5.10.9. Write Protection 1-12
1.5.10.10. Copyright Protection 1-12
2. Product Specifications? 2-1
2.1. System Environmental Specifications.. 2-1
2.2. Reliability and Durability 2-1
2.3. Typical Card Power Requirements. 2-2
2.4. System Performance. 2-2
2.5. System Reliability and Maintenance . 2-2
2.6. Physical Specifications 2-3
3. SD Card Interface Description? 3-1
3.1. General Description of Pins and Registers. 3-1
3.1.1. Pin Assignments in SD Card Mode . 3-1
Table of Contents
iv SanDisk Secure Digital (SD) Card Product Manual, Rev. 1.9 . 2003 SANDISK CORPORATION
3.1.2. Pin Assignments in SPI Mode. 3-2
3.2. SD Bus Topology.. 3-3
3.2.1. Power Protection? 3-5
3.3. SPI Bus Topology .. 3-5
3.3.1. Power Protection? 3-6
3.4. Electrical Interface . 3-6
3.4.1. Power-up .. 3-7
3.4.2. Bus Operating Conditions. 3-8
3.4.3. Bus Signal Line Load.. 3-8
3.4.4. Bus Signal Levels.. 3-9
3.4.5. Bus Timing.. 3-10
3.5. SD Card Registers .. 3-11
3.5.1. Operating Conditions Register (OCR)? 3-11
3.5.2. Card Identification (CID) Register 3-12
3.5.3. CSD Register.. 3-13
3.5.4. SCR Register.. 3-19
3.5.5. Status Register 3-20
3.5.6. SD Status.. 3-23
3.5.7. RCA Register .. 3-23
3.5.8. SD Card Registers in SPI Mode. 3-24
3.6. Data Interchange Format and Card Sizes? 3-24
4. Secure Digital (SD) Card Protocol Description.. 4-1
4.1. SD Bus Protocol. 4-1
4.2. Protocol’s Functional Description.. 4-4
4.3. Card Identification Mode? 4-5
4.3.1. Reset 4-6
4.3.2. Operating Voltage Range Validation .. 4-7
4.3.3. Card Identification Process .. 4-7
4.4. Data Transfer Mode .. 4-8
4.4.1. Wide Bus Selection/Deselection? 4-10
4.4.2. Data Read Format . 4-10
4.4.3. Data Write Format? 4-11
4.4.4. Write Protect Management .. 4-13
4.4.4.1. Mechanical Write Protect Switch .. 4-13
4.4.4.2. Card’s Internal Write Protection (Optional) . 4-13
4.4.5. Application Specific Commands 4-13
4.5. Clock Control .. 4-14
4.6. Cyclic Redundancy Codes (CRC).. 4-15
4.7. Error Conditions. 4-17
4.7.1. CRC and Illegal Command .. 4-17
4.7.2. Read, Write and Erase Time-out Conditions .. 4-17
4.8. Commands. 4-17
4.8.1. Command Types? 4-18
4.8.2. Command Format.. 4-18
4.8.3. Command Classes . 4-18
4.8.4. Detailed Command Description . 4-20
4.9. Card State Transition Table 4-24
4.10. Responses 4-25
4.11. Timings? 4-27
4.11.1. Command and Response . 4-27
4.11.2. Data Read.. 4-28
Table of Contents
SanDisk Secure Digital (SD) Card Product Manual, Rev. 1.9 . 2003 SANDISK CORPORATION v
4.11.3. Data Write. 4-29
4.11.4. Timing Values.. 4-32
5. SPI Protocol Definition . 5-1
5.1. SPI Bus Protocol . 5-1
5.1.1. Mode Selection .. 5-1
5.1.2. Bus Transfer Protection . 5-2
5.1.3. Data Read. 5-2
5.1.4. Data Write 5-3
5.1.5. Erase and Write Protect Management. 5-4
5.1.6. Read CID/CSD Registers.. 5-4
5.1.7. Reset Sequence .. 5-5
5.1.8. Clock Control. 5-5
5.1.9. Error Conditions 5-6
5.1.9.1. CRC and Illegal Commands . 5-6
5.1.9.2. Read, Write and Erase Time-out Conditions? 5-6
5.1.10. Memory Array Partitioning 5-8
5.1.11. Card Lock/Unlock.. 5-8
5.1.12. Application Specific Commands. 5-8
5.1.13. Copyright Protection Commands 5-8
5.2. SPI Command Set .. 5-8
5.2.1. Command Format.. 5-8
5.2.2. Command Classes . 5-9
5.2.2.1. Detailed Command Description.. 5-9
5.2.3. Responses. 5-12
5.2.3.1. Format R1 .. 5-13
5.2.3.2. Format R1b? 5-13
5.2.3.3. Format R2 .. 5-13
5.2.3.4. Format R3 .. 5-14
5.2.3.5. Data Response . 5-15
5.2.4. Data Tokens . 5-15
5.2.5. Data Error Token .. 5-16
5.2.6. Clearing Status Bits.. 5-16
5.3. Card Registers . 5-16
5.4. SPI Bus Timing Diagrams.. 5-16
5.4.1. Command/Response. 5-17
5.4.2. Data Read. 5-18
5.4.3. Data Write 5-18
5.4.4. Timing Values. 5-19
5.5. SPI Electrical Interface. 5-19
5.6. SPI Bus Operating Conditions . 5-19
5.7. Bus Timing 5-19
Appendix A. Application Note A-1
Host Design Considerations: NAND MMC and SD-based Products
Introduction? A-1
Timing.. A-1
Timing specifications . A-1
Read access and program times. A-1
Interface A-2
Read/Write Mode Selection? A-4
Power and Clock Control . A-4
Initialization Algorithm A-5
Table of Contents
vi SanDisk Secure Digital (SD) Card Product Manual, Rev. 1.9 . 2003 SANDISK CORPORATION
File System Support .. A-5
Appendix B. Ordering Information? B-1
Appendix C. SanDisk Worldwide Sales Offices . C-1
Appendix D. Limited Warranty.. D-1
Appendix E. Disclaimer of Liability . E-1
1.1. Scope 1-2
1.2. Product Models .. 1-2
1.3. System Features.. 1-2
1.4. SD Card Standard.. 1-3
1.5. Functional Description . 1-3
1.5.1. Flash Technology Independence 1-4
1.5.2. Defect and Error Management? 1-4
1.5.3. Copyright Protection? 1-4
1.5.4. Endurance . 1-5
1.5.5. Wear Leveling 1-5
1.5.6. Using the Erase Command 1-5
1.5.7. Automatic Sleep Mode 1-5
1.5.8. Hot Insertion? 1-5
1.5.9. SD Card—SD Bus Mode .. 1-6
1.5.9.1. SD Card Standard Compliance? 1-6
1.5.9.2. Negotiating Operation Conditions . 1-6
1.5.9.3. Card Acquisition and Identification.. 1-6
1.5.9.4. Card Status. 1-6
1.5.9.5. Memory Array Partitioning 1-7
1.5.9.6. Read and Write Operations 1-9
1.5.9.7. Data Transfer Rate . 1-9
1.5.9.8. Data Protection in the Flash Card .. 1-10
1.5.9.9. Erase . 1-10
1.5.9.10. Write Protection 1-10
1.5.9.11. Copy Bit 1-10
1.5.9.12. The CSD Register? 1-10
1.5.10. SD Card—SPI Mode. 1-10
1.5.10.1. Negotiating Operating Conditions .. 1-11
1.5.10.2. Card Acquisition and Identification 1-11
1.5.10.3. Card Status.. 1-11
1.5.10.4. Memory Array Partitioning. 1-11
1.5.10.5. Read and Write Operations. 1-11
1.5.10.6. Data Transfer Rate .. 1-11
1.5.10.7. Data Protection in the SD Card. 1-11
1.5.10.8. Erase .. 1-11
1.5.10.9. Write Protection 1-12
1.5.10.10. Copyright Protection 1-12
2. Product Specifications? 2-1
2.1. System Environmental Specifications.. 2-1
2.2. Reliability and Durability 2-1
2.3. Typical Card Power Requirements. 2-2
2.4. System Performance. 2-2
2.5. System Reliability and Maintenance . 2-2
2.6. Physical Specifications 2-3
3. SD Card Interface Description? 3-1
3.1. General Description of Pins and Registers. 3-1
3.1.1. Pin Assignments in SD Card Mode . 3-1
Table of Contents
iv SanDisk Secure Digital (SD) Card Product Manual, Rev. 1.9 . 2003 SANDISK CORPORATION
3.1.2. Pin Assignments in SPI Mode. 3-2
3.2. SD Bus Topology.. 3-3
3.2.1. Power Protection? 3-5
3.3. SPI Bus Topology .. 3-5
3.3.1. Power Protection? 3-6
3.4. Electrical Interface . 3-6
3.4.1. Power-up .. 3-7
3.4.2. Bus Operating Conditions. 3-8
3.4.3. Bus Signal Line Load.. 3-8
3.4.4. Bus Signal Levels.. 3-9
3.4.5. Bus Timing.. 3-10
3.5. SD Card Registers .. 3-11
3.5.1. Operating Conditions Register (OCR)? 3-11
3.5.2. Card Identification (CID) Register 3-12
3.5.3. CSD Register.. 3-13
3.5.4. SCR Register.. 3-19
3.5.5. Status Register 3-20
3.5.6. SD Status.. 3-23
3.5.7. RCA Register .. 3-23
3.5.8. SD Card Registers in SPI Mode. 3-24
3.6. Data Interchange Format and Card Sizes? 3-24
4. Secure Digital (SD) Card Protocol Description.. 4-1
4.1. SD Bus Protocol. 4-1
4.2. Protocol’s Functional Description.. 4-4
4.3. Card Identification Mode? 4-5
4.3.1. Reset 4-6
4.3.2. Operating Voltage Range Validation .. 4-7
4.3.3. Card Identification Process .. 4-7
4.4. Data Transfer Mode .. 4-8
4.4.1. Wide Bus Selection/Deselection? 4-10
4.4.2. Data Read Format . 4-10
4.4.3. Data Write Format? 4-11
4.4.4. Write Protect Management .. 4-13
4.4.4.1. Mechanical Write Protect Switch .. 4-13
4.4.4.2. Card’s Internal Write Protection (Optional) . 4-13
4.4.5. Application Specific Commands 4-13
4.5. Clock Control .. 4-14
4.6. Cyclic Redundancy Codes (CRC).. 4-15
4.7. Error Conditions. 4-17
4.7.1. CRC and Illegal Command .. 4-17
4.7.2. Read, Write and Erase Time-out Conditions .. 4-17
4.8. Commands. 4-17
4.8.1. Command Types? 4-18
4.8.2. Command Format.. 4-18
4.8.3. Command Classes . 4-18
4.8.4. Detailed Command Description . 4-20
4.9. Card State Transition Table 4-24
4.10. Responses 4-25
4.11. Timings? 4-27
4.11.1. Command and Response . 4-27
4.11.2. Data Read.. 4-28
Table of Contents
SanDisk Secure Digital (SD) Card Product Manual, Rev. 1.9 . 2003 SANDISK CORPORATION v
4.11.3. Data Write. 4-29
4.11.4. Timing Values.. 4-32
5. SPI Protocol Definition . 5-1
5.1. SPI Bus Protocol . 5-1
5.1.1. Mode Selection .. 5-1
5.1.2. Bus Transfer Protection . 5-2
5.1.3. Data Read. 5-2
5.1.4. Data Write 5-3
5.1.5. Erase and Write Protect Management. 5-4
5.1.6. Read CID/CSD Registers.. 5-4
5.1.7. Reset Sequence .. 5-5
5.1.8. Clock Control. 5-5
5.1.9. Error Conditions 5-6
5.1.9.1. CRC and Illegal Commands . 5-6
5.1.9.2. Read, Write and Erase Time-out Conditions? 5-6
5.1.10. Memory Array Partitioning 5-8
5.1.11. Card Lock/Unlock.. 5-8
5.1.12. Application Specific Commands. 5-8
5.1.13. Copyright Protection Commands 5-8
5.2. SPI Command Set .. 5-8
5.2.1. Command Format.. 5-8
5.2.2. Command Classes . 5-9
5.2.2.1. Detailed Command Description.. 5-9
5.2.3. Responses. 5-12
5.2.3.1. Format R1 .. 5-13
5.2.3.2. Format R1b? 5-13
5.2.3.3. Format R2 .. 5-13
5.2.3.4. Format R3 .. 5-14
5.2.3.5. Data Response . 5-15
5.2.4. Data Tokens . 5-15
5.2.5. Data Error Token .. 5-16
5.2.6. Clearing Status Bits.. 5-16
5.3. Card Registers . 5-16
5.4. SPI Bus Timing Diagrams.. 5-16
5.4.1. Command/Response. 5-17
5.4.2. Data Read. 5-18
5.4.3. Data Write 5-18
5.4.4. Timing Values. 5-19
5.5. SPI Electrical Interface. 5-19
5.6. SPI Bus Operating Conditions . 5-19
5.7. Bus Timing 5-19
Appendix A. Application Note A-1
Host Design Considerations: NAND MMC and SD-based Products
Introduction? A-1
Timing.. A-1
Timing specifications . A-1
Read access and program times. A-1
Interface A-2
Read/Write Mode Selection? A-4
Power and Clock Control . A-4
Initialization Algorithm A-5
Table of Contents
vi SanDisk Secure Digital (SD) Card Product Manual, Rev. 1.9 . 2003 SANDISK CORPORATION
File System Support .. A-5
Appendix B. Ordering Information? B-1
Appendix C. SanDisk Worldwide Sales Offices . C-1
Appendix D. Limited Warranty.. D-1
Appendix E. Disclaimer of Liability . E-1
下載該資料的人也在下載
下載該資料的人還在閱讀
更多 >
- SD卡2.0協議資料英文版 0次下載
- 基于SPI協議的SD卡讀寫說明 49次下載
- SD卡的99SE封裝庫免費下載 43次下載
- SD卡的99SE封裝庫免費下載 13次下載
- 使用單片機實現SD卡讀寫的資料和程序免費下載
- 如何使用單片機讀寫SD卡
- SD卡資料 7次下載
- SD卡要點說明 265次下載
- SD卡分類簡介
- SD卡命令解釋
- sd卡-mmc卡-CPU說明資料
- 迷你SD卡標準
- sd卡接口規范(完整規范標準)
- sd卡接口電路
- sd標準/MMC卡標準
- 貼片式SD卡功能介紹【MK SD NAND】 385次閱讀
- sd卡是什么有什么用途 TF卡和SD卡有什么區別 3853次閱讀
- sd卡是什么有什么用途 TF卡和SD卡有什么區別 2011次閱讀
- SD卡的分類以及常見屬性 3667次閱讀
- TF卡和SD卡的區別有哪些? 8238次閱讀
- 怎么通過FPGA采取SD模式實現Micro SD卡的驅動 1691次閱讀
- SD/micro SD存儲卡介紹 1577次閱讀
- 一文了解microSD卡和SD卡的區別 9726次閱讀
- 干貨 | SD卡/TF卡的PCB布局布線設計要求 2.5w次閱讀
- AT89C52單片機與SD卡實現通訊的設計方案 2996次閱讀
- SD卡的接口是怎樣設計的 1.1w次閱讀
- spi讀取sd卡數據例程 8823次閱讀
- 單片機讀取sd卡數據_51單片機讀寫SD卡程序詳解 2.3w次閱讀
- mmc卡和sd卡的區別是什么 4.7w次閱讀
- SD卡UHS-III、A2、LV三大新標準梳理 1.3w次閱讀
下載排行
本周
- 1電子電路原理第七版PDF電子教材免費下載
- 0.00 MB | 1490次下載 | 免費
- 2單片機典型實例介紹
- 18.19 MB | 93次下載 | 1 積分
- 3S7-200PLC編程實例詳細資料
- 1.17 MB | 27次下載 | 1 積分
- 4筆記本電腦主板的元件識別和講解說明
- 4.28 MB | 18次下載 | 4 積分
- 5開關電源原理及各功能電路詳解
- 0.38 MB | 10次下載 | 免費
- 6基于AT89C2051/4051單片機編程器的實驗
- 0.11 MB | 4次下載 | 免費
- 7基于單片機和 SG3525的程控開關電源設計
- 0.23 MB | 3次下載 | 免費
- 8基于單片機的紅外風扇遙控
- 0.23 MB | 3次下載 | 免費
本月
- 1OrCAD10.5下載OrCAD10.5中文版軟件
- 0.00 MB | 234313次下載 | 免費
- 2PADS 9.0 2009最新版 -下載
- 0.00 MB | 66304次下載 | 免費
- 3protel99下載protel99軟件下載(中文版)
- 0.00 MB | 51209次下載 | 免費
- 4LabView 8.0 專業版下載 (3CD完整版)
- 0.00 MB | 51043次下載 | 免費
- 5555集成電路應用800例(新編版)
- 0.00 MB | 33562次下載 | 免費
- 6接口電路圖大全
- 未知 | 30320次下載 | 免費
- 7Multisim 10下載Multisim 10 中文版
- 0.00 MB | 28588次下載 | 免費
- 8開關電源設計實例指南
- 未知 | 21539次下載 | 免費
總榜
- 1matlab軟件下載入口
- 未知 | 935053次下載 | 免費
- 2protel99se軟件下載(可英文版轉中文版)
- 78.1 MB | 537791次下載 | 免費
- 3MATLAB 7.1 下載 (含軟件介紹)
- 未知 | 420026次下載 | 免費
- 4OrCAD10.5下載OrCAD10.5中文版軟件
- 0.00 MB | 234313次下載 | 免費
- 5Altium DXP2002下載入口
- 未知 | 233046次下載 | 免費
- 6電路仿真軟件multisim 10.0免費下載
- 340992 | 191183次下載 | 免費
- 7十天學會AVR單片機與C語言視頻教程 下載
- 158M | 183277次下載 | 免費
- 8proe5.0野火版下載(中文版免費下載)
- 未知 | 138039次下載 | 免費
評論
查看更多